Which statement best describes the overall aim of Managing Legal Risk?

Explanation:
Managing Legal Risk aims to limit liability if something goes wrong. In practice, this means putting safeguards in place so clients are protected and trainers are protected if an incident occurs. That includes clear informed consent, proper screening, up-to-date safety protocols, equipment maintenance, emergency procedures, thorough documentation, and appropriate insurance. By focusing on preventing harm and reducing potential legal exposure, you create a safer, more accountable practice. Other choices relate to business goals rather than reducing legal risk. Maximizing profit at any cost, expanding services, or cutting staff might affect risk in various ways, but they don’t describe the purpose of managing legal risk itself.
